Choking Prevention Strategies

Choking is among the most typical emergency situations that can accompany toddlers. Recognizing how to prevent choking is crucial for all caregivers.

Common Choking Hazards

    Small toys Hard candies Grapes Nuts

Effective Preventative Measures

Always manage young children throughout meals. Cut foods right into tiny pieces. Educate older brother or sisters regarding secure play practices.

Epipen Administration: A Lifesaving Skill

For youngsters with recognized allergies, having an Epipen accessible can suggest the distinction between life and death.

How to Administer an Epipen

Remove the safety cap. Hold the pen against the outer thigh. Press firmly till you hear a click. Hold in place for 10 secs before removing.

Steps to Handle Cuts and Scrapes

Clean the injury with soap and water. Apply an antiseptic clean or cream. Cover with a sterilized bandage.

Recognizing Bronchial asthma Symptoms Early On

Asthma can materialize suddenly in little ones; recognizing signs and symptoms early can result in timely intervention.

Common Symptoms of Bronchial asthma in Toddlers

    Wheezing or coughing Shortness of breath Chest tightness

Childproofing Strategies Every Parent Need To Implement

Creating a risk-free environment includes childproofing your home effectively.

Essential Childproofing Practices Include:

    Installing security gates at stairs Securing heavy furniture to walls Using electrical outlet covers

What should I consist of in my child care centre first aid kit?

A detailed childcare centre first aid set should consist of adhesive tapes, antibacterial wipes, gauze pads, scissors, adhesive tape, tweezers, instantaneous cold packs, gloves, shed cream, emergency get in touch with numbers, CPR guidelines specifically customized for infants/toddlers like Infant m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Australia guidelines, etc.
